What is being procured?
LMETB is seeking proposals from interested service providers who wish to be considered for the provision of an Irish Sign Language Interpreter Service. The successful tenderer will provide qualified and experienced Irish Sign Language (ISL) interpreters to support learners who are Deaf or hard of hearing across a range of educational settings. Interpreters will be required to work in primary and post-primary schools, as well as in Further Education and Training (FET) colleges. Interpreting assignments will involve a broad variety of subject areas and learning environments, including both practical and theoretical modules. This may include, but is not limited to, academic subjects, vocational training, workshops, tutorials, laboratory sessions, and extracurricular activities. .
